[Detailed description of the invention] (Field of industrial application) The present invention provides a locking device for a lid body that covers the armrest of an automobile seat in which a container is embedded inside so that it can be used as an article storage device. Regarding.

(Prior Art) As shown in FIG. 7, the conventional armrest with a container releases the locked state of the lid B' that covers the container A' by operating a lever a provided on the front side of the armrest. Next, the lid is opened by pulling the strap b.

By the way, when an armrest with such a structure is equipped with a control unit (a unit that houses the operating section for adjusting the seat tilt angle, opening/closing the car window, etc.) on the front side of the body, this unit can be used to control the lever. An operating section for opening and closing the lid B' such as a cannot be provided on the front side of the armrest.

Therefore, if a container with a lid is buried behind the control unit, it is necessary to provide an operating section for opening and closing the lid. It is desirable that this operating section be disposed on the top side of the lid so that it can be used by the left and right occupants seated on the seat. There are various types of operation parts that can be used to open and close the lid (for example, one that unlocks the lid by sliding the operating lever, one that unlocks the lid by pulling the strap, etc.) ),
It is preferable to use a push button to release the lock because it does not spoil the appearance of the armrest (sliding type has a long hole for sliding, and strap type has a strap exposed on the surface of the armrest).

If the lid is automatically lifted from the top surface of the container when the lock is released by the push button, the lid can be easily opened. Therefore,
One possible method is to lift the lid upward by springing the lock piece upward by the elasticity of a spring provided on the container side after the lock is released.

However, according to this method, the lock piece is spring-loaded upward before and after the lock, so when the lock piece is operated between the locked state and the unlocked state, the spring spring makes the operation smooth. There was a problem in that it was not possible to do this properly and it was not possible to ensure the locked state.

(Purpose) Therefore, the purpose of the present invention is to improve the operability of the locking piece and to ensure the locked state in an armrest having a structure in which the lid is opened by releasing the locked state of the lid against the container using a push button. It is to do so.

(Structure) The gist of the present invention to achieve the above purpose is to provide a locking hole in which a lock piece on the lid side engages with the container side to which the lid is covered, and a locking hole built in the locking hole. A pusher is provided to press upward, and on the other hand, a lock piece is provided on the lid side that engages with the locking hole and is rotatably pivoted, and a lock piece that is fixed near the lock piece and has a receptacle with respect to the lock piece. An insertion piece is provided that projects a large amount in the lateral direction and is inserted into the locking hole against the pressing force of the presser.

(Function) When locking by inserting the lock piece on the lid side and the insertion piece into the locking hole against the pressing force of the presser on the container side and engaging the lock piece with the locking hole, the Since the length of the insert piece is longer than the lock piece, the push piece in the locking hole is pushed downward by the insert piece, and the push piece does not come into contact with the lock piece. Further, when releasing the locked state, the insertion piece receives the pressing force of the pressing element. Therefore, when locking or releasing the lock, the pressing force of the presser on the container side that lifts the lid upward does not act on the lock piece, so the lock piece operates smoothly and the lock is released. will also be certain.

(Effects) According to the present invention, the lock piece and insertion piece inserted into the locking hole of the container are longer than the lock piece in the direction of the container side, so that when the lock is released, The pressing force of the presser on the container side that lifts the lid is regulated by the insertion piece, so that the pressing force of the presser does not directly act on the lock piece.

Therefore, the lock piece operates smoothly and its operability is improved. Moreover, since the locking piece is not affected by the pressing force of the pressing element, locking is performed reliably.
